Frequently Asked Questions Why Live in Newton

Is Newton a good place to live?
Newton is a good place to live. Newton is considered car-dependent and somewhat bikeable. Newton has 1 park for recreational activities. It has a median age of 44. The average household income is $73,691 which is below the national average. College graduates make up 18.1% of residents. A majority of residents in Newton are home owners, with 25.8% of residents renting and 74.2% of residents owning their home. Is Newton, IL a safe neighborhood?
Newton, IL is safer than the average neighborhood in the United States. It received a crime score of 3 out of 10.
How much do you need to make to afford a house in Newton?
The median home price in Newton is $135,000. If you put a 20% down payment of $27,000 and had a 30-year fixed mortgage with an interest rate of 6.75%, your estimated principal and interest payment would be $700 a month plus property taxes, HOA fees, home insurance, PMI, and utilities. Using the 28% rule, you would need to make at least $30K a year to afford the median home price in Newton. The average household income in Newton is $74K.
